South Zone clinches BCL title with emphatic victory

DHAKA, Feb 25, 2020 (BSS)- A rampant South Zone came all guns blazing to
register a massive 105-run victory over Islami Bank East Zone in the final of
the eighth Bangladesh Cricket League (BCL) at the Zahur Ahmed Chowdhury
Stadium on Tuesday.

This was the South Zone’s fifth title in the premier first class cricket
tournament of the country. Resuming the day four of the five-day final on
125-8, South Zone was finally bowled out for 140 in their second innings,
setting a 354-run target for the East Zone to clinch the title.

East Zone, however, couldn’t survive and eventually was wrapped up for 248
to concede the heavy defeat.

Only Mahmudul Hasan Limon could make some resistance before being dismissed
for team highest 81. Zakir Hasan was the other notable scorer with 42 while
Afif Hossain made 31.

Pace bowler Shafiul Islam was the wrecker-in-chief, claiming 3-56 with
which he sliced the top order of East Zone. Mahedi Hasan then cleaned up the
tail with a figure of 3-66. Farhad Reza scalped 2-51 to give them ably
support.

Earlier, Mahedi made 53 after resuming the day on overnight 41. He in fact
made 12 runs of South Zone’s 15 on the day. Hasan Mahmud and Abu Haider Rony
picked up four wickets apiece while Ruyel Mea grabbed two.

But, despite being bowled out for 140, South Zone could throw tough target
for East Zone, largely due to their first innings total.

Being sent to bat first, South Zone compiled 486 in its first innings
before being all out, thanks to a 103 not out from Farhad Reza. Openers Fazle
Mahmud and Anamul Haque Bijoy scored 86 and 76 runs respectively while
Shamsur Rahman Shuvo made 79.

In reply, East Zone was dismissed for 273, conceding a 213 runs lead. They
though could bowl out South Zone for 140 in the second innings, the huge
deficit of first innings became the eventual difference.
